A week after the City Council’s planning subcommittee approved an affordable housing project that would bring close to 1,000 apartments to Melrose in the Bronx, the full Council has jumped on board as well.
The city council’s planning subcommittee has approved a Mandatory Inclusionary Housing program at La Central that will bring a five-building development with 992 affordable units into the Bronx’s Melrose neighborhood.
